Output 337842730edd90dafee02632f22ecb2ce1957c1719ca7100cb4e99f28b2fd6fc:15

value
1771000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71d731375627d30a846c39a7d1099dfe969bb52c OP_EQUAL
address
3C4x53HnBGFK2pqCpZAetcwg2TfUsEXxzU
transaction
337842730edd90dafee02632f22ecb2ce1957c1719ca7100cb4e99f28b2fd6fc
spent
true